Legal Operations Manager
We’re looking for a Legal Operations Manager to join our growing Legal Team in London.
This role is a unique opportunity to shape and streamline our operational processes, enhance efficiency and productivity, and support the Legal, Privacy, and Company Secretarial teams to help deliver Wise’s mission of money without borders.
Your Mission
Wise continues to pioneer new ways for people and businesses to send, spend, receive and manage their money across borders and currencies.
Your mission is to innovate and drive efficiency within our legal operations, enabling the Legal Tribe to perform at its best and support the broader business.
About The Role
Operational Processes: Implement and manage operational processes to enhance efficiency and boost productivity. Recommend and execute improvements to streamline workflows, such as optimising hiring and onboarding, how Wisers seek assistance from the Legal Tribe and ensuring efficient updating and maintenance of Wise''s global terms and conditions.Team management. Work with our People Partner to help develop and manage a high-performing team, including through performance reviews, implementing action plans from employee feedback, updating career maps with aligned compensation, and optimising hiring and onboarding.Technology and Tooling: Evaluate, select, implement and manage appropriate technologies and tooling to support the Legal Tribe''s needs.Project Management: Lead and manage cross-team projects, ensuring successful delivery within scope, time, and budget constraints.Spend Monitoring: Keep a close eye on external spend, including managing relationships, invoices and budgets for external counsel, insurance providers and other third-party vendors.Budgeting and Forecasting: Assist with the budgeting and forecasting process to ensure financial resources are allocated effectively and align with strategic goals.Knowledge Management: Own the knowledge management process, including maintaining internal intranet pages and managing both external and internal legal advice. Develop efficient document storage solutions, including evidence handling.Contracts Lifecycle Management: Operationalise contracts lifecycle and contract management to ensure seamless handling and tracking of contracts from initiation to execution.Training and Development: Organise external training programs for the Legal, Privacy, and Company Secretarial teams to advance their professional development and stay updated with industry best practices.Matter Tracking: Monitor and track key deals, ensuring documentation and timelines are adhered to.

About You
Demonstrated track record in successfully managing complex projects related to legal operations, technology implementation, global insurance programmes and process improvement.Exceptional project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ple initiatives simultaneously.Strong preference for candidates who can demonstrate their ability to analyse metrics and generate reports using tools such as SQL.Strong ability to build relationships and work collaboratively across different teams.Meticulous attention to detail and a commitment to delivering high-quality outputs.Proficiency in evaluating and implementing technologies to improve efficiency.Experience in budgeting and financial management.Have a get-it-done, collaborative approach to problem solving.
